Furniture is an important part of home furnishing. In addition to its functionality, it can also determine the style and atmosphere of the room. The choice of material for the manufacture of outdoor and indoor furniture is one of the most important aspects when choosing it. Wood is one of the most popular materials for making outdoor and indoor furniture and there are many different types of wood that can be used for this purpose. In this article, we will look at the different types of trees and their characteristics to help you choose the material for making furniture in your home.

 

Teak

 

 

Teak wood furniture can be a great choice for tropical, Balinese, Asian, exotic, and contemporary interiors. This type of wood has a light brown or dark brown color and is highly durable and resistant to moisture, rot, and insects, making it ideal for use as outdoor furniture as well as indoors.

 

Birch

 

 

Birch is a light and soft material for furniture. It has a light tone and fine texture, making it a popular choice for contemporary furniture. However, birch is not as durable as other trees and can wear out quickly. It also has low abrasion and scratch resistance, making it less suitable for furniture that will be used frequently.

 

Walnut

 

 

Walnut is a hard and durable wood that has a dark brown hue and a fine texture. It also has high abrasion and scratch resistance, making it an excellent choice for home furnishings. Walnut can have a smooth or rough texture, and is easily stained and takes on stains and tints.

 

Mahogany

 

 

Mahogany is a hard and durable wood that is known for its deep red color and fine texture. It also has high abrasion and scratch resistance, making it an excellent choice for home furnishings. Mahogany has a smooth texture and usually does not require staining or tinting.

 

Oak

 

 

Oak is one of the most popular types of wood for making furniture. It is known for its durability, abrasion resistance, and attractive texture. Oak also has excellent bending strength, allowing for beautiful curves in furniture. It is available in various shades, from light brown to dark brown, and can have a smooth or rough texture. Oak is also great for staining and takes on stains and tints easily.

 

Ash

 

 

Ash is also a strong and durable furniture material. It is highly resistant to abrasion and scratches and has excellent bending strength. Ash has a fine texture and is available in a variety of shades, from pale brown to dark brown. It can have a smooth or rough texture and is easy to stain and take on blemishes and tints.

 

Maple

 

 

Maple is a soft and lightweight furniture material. It has a light shade and a wonderful texture. Maple stains easily and can take on stains and tints. It also has high abrasion and scratch resistance, making it an excellent choice for home furnishings. Maple also has bending strength, but not as high as oak and ash.

 

Results

The choice of material for the manufacture of furniture is an important aspect that must be considered when furnishing a home. Different types of trees have different characteristics and you need to choose the one that best suits your needs and preferences. Oak, ash, and walnut are strong and durable furniture materials, while birch and maple are light and soft. Mahogany has a unique dark red hue and a fine texture. When choosing a material for furniture, it is also necessary to take into account the interior design of the room in which it will be used, so that it is combined with other decorative elements.
